All gift funds for the down payment must comply with the same rules that apply to the FHA loan applicant for the down payment. The gift funds cannot come from a payday loan, credit card cash advance, or non-collateralized loans.

Gift funds are commonly used for home loan expenses including down payments, but when the borrower accepts gift funds for the purpose of making that down payment, the funds must meet FHA acceptability standards. What does this mean? FHA loan rules are very precise when it comes to the source of money used for a down payment.
